First Halloween Footage Teases Tomorrow’s Trailer

Ahead of tomorrow's big trailer reveal, Blumhouse has released the first footage from the upcoming Halloween sequel/reboot.

David Gordon Green’s Halloween sequel/reboot is officially in the can.

After a relatively short spell in front of the cameras, during which time Jamie Lee Curtis (Laurie Strode) shared numerous set photos, filming on the pic has now wrapped and that can only mean one thing: it’s time for the marketing machine to kick into high gear – which it definitely has.

Because with only a handful of months remaining now until Halloween storms into theaters and scares the living daylights out of us all, Michael Myers is ready for round two, and we now have a good idea of what that’ll look like, as Blumhouse has finally delivered the very first footage from the pic. Granted, this is only the teaser for the full trailer, but it does provide us with a lot to feast on, showing off Myers in all his glory and promising an epic confrontation between Laurie and the demented serial killer.

As for the real deal, it’s due to hit the web tomorrow and promises to be every bit as bone-chilling as John Carpenter’s cult classic from ’78. As we mentioned before, Curtis is back as Laurie and the actress and all-around scream queen legend has already warned fans that they’re in for an absolutely terrifying experience – something we don’t doubt.

Hell, the reactions from CinemaCon were so overwhelmingly positive that Halloween now finds itself among some of the most anticipated films of 2018. Whether it can live up to all the hype remains to be seen, but everything we’ve heard so far has us eagerly anticipating the return of Mr. Myers and come tomorrow morning, we’ll be able to see for ourselves what the franchise has cooked up for its next outing.

Haddonfield swings its doors open to Halloween once more when David Gordon Green’s follow-up creeps out of the shadows and into theaters on October 19th. Stay tuned to WGTC for full coverage of what is sure to be a spooky trailer reveal on Friday.
